- [ ] **Key Ceremony Step 7 — Cron Migration Cutover (Project Ostrevane).** Before signing the new workflow-engine keys, confirm every legacy cron job has a matching Driftline DAG and that the last cron run completed cleanly. Pause the cron daemon, record the final tick in the ceremony log, and have both witnesses initial it. The ceremony safe will only release the signing token once you enter the recovery passphrase below.

recovery phrase for bawif-yawif: gorwyn-kelix-zorox-silath-novix-juleth

## Configuration: Per-Tenant Rate Quotas

Quotas for Brinlet tenants live in quotas.toml. Defaults: 600 req/min standard, 2400 burst for tier-A. Reload with `brinletctl quota reload`; no restart needed. Release builds must ship with quota enforcement on, which requires the quota-service credential in the runtime env. Set it by adding this line to release.env:

vault entry, yajop-bafop: ARCHIVE_KEY3=8d4

Plugin authors should develop exclusively against sandbox, where dedup windows are shortened so suppression behavior can be observed quickly. Staging mirrors production topology but receives synthetic alert streams only, making it suitable for final validation. Production access is never granted to plugins directly; they interact through the published hook interface. Each environment applies its own dedup and routing parameters, and the sandbox environment currently runs with the following configuration.

settings of tagef-bawif:
DRUIX_HOST=druix.zemvarlabs.internal
DRUIX_PORT=8000

Hey release folks — quick heads-up on Spokewise, our bike-share rebalancing tool. The new depot-priority heuristic is in and it finally stops sending empty vans to the Harrowgate docks at rush hour. Simulations on last month's Bellport data show a 12% drop in stockouts. Jonas wants this in Thursday's train if QA signs off tomorrow. For tracking purposes, the candidate is identified by the token below.

pipeline stamp: htk31_f769b577b3028a4e9958e5bb8d1259a